Maintenance Technician L1-2

Maintenance Technician L1-2
Organization:Steam Operations
Department:59th Street Station
Job Code:W12137
Job Requirements:Five years in-depth work experience in the field of a Power Generation or related industries required. Duties include, but not limited to work experience in facilities such as fossil/nuclear power plants, industrial plants, steam boiler/engine rooms, oil refineries, combustion turbine facilities, ship yards, airline maintenance facilities, etc. Significant experience working on various types of mechanical equipment is required. Candidate must have basic knowledge of PC computer systems.
An Associate Applied Science technical degree or equivalent is desirable. Experience in maintaining, repairing and installing power piping systems, associated valves, tanks and vessels and various types of rotating mechanical equipment such as fans, blowers, pumps, motors, etc. is required. All applicants must know how to use various field power tools and precision measuring equipment. A basic working knowledge is required in the following areas: confined space entry, basic pumps, coupling alignment, bearing maintenance, pipe fitting, oxy-acetylene torch cutting, rigging, scaffolding, mechanical drawing, boiler tube repair, math and industrial safety.
In addition, a basic working knowledge in the following areas of expertise is preferred: machine shop, conduit bending, basic electricity, skyclimber/hanging platforms, crane operation and welding (GTAW, SMAW).
Estimate manpower resources, materials, special tools and equipment required to perform corrective and preventative maintenance of power plant equipment and piping systems. Develop job plans as required to complete each job in an effective and timely manner. Candidate will originate purchase and class/stock orders and will follow up on the status of those orders. Assure that all work orders and equipment history are entered in the required computer systems. Consult and review technical manuals, instruction books, prints, sketches, manufacturer''s catalogs, equipment history records and other references for specifications and performance information to assist in planning process. Identify spare parts and equipment located in various storerooms for use in field repairs. Work with EH&S, Engineering and other Departments, as necessary, to gather information to be used in Job Plans. May perform special job related assignments and studies as required. Candidate must have good oral and written communication skills.
Physical Requirements:The selected candidate must be able to perform heavy manual labor (push, pull and lift 45-60 lbs.) and to do extensive walking, standing and climbing. Candidate must be willing to work in a physically demanding work environment (i.e., work in all weather conditions, in confined spaces and in hot and cold ambient temperatures). Candidate must be clean shaven and medically approved to wear a respirator to include fit testing for 1/2 face, full face and SCBA respirator use. Must possess and maintain a valid driver''s license. This position may involve working back shifts, overtime and weekends as required to support station operation.
